Weather-Responsive Watering
Weather-responsive watering systems utilize smart climate sensing units to enhance irrigation timetables based on existing environmental problems. These systems consist of rainfall delay performance, which avoids unnecessary watering during damp weather condition, and seasonal modifications that customize water use to varying environment patterns. Because of this, they enhance water performance and promote healthier landscapes.
Smart Weather Sensors
Smart weather condition sensing units have revolutionized the effectiveness of modern watering systems by changing sprinkling schedules based on real-time environmental information. These sensors check variables such as temperature level, moisture, wind speed, and solar radiation, allowing systems to react dynamically to altering climate conditions. By incorporating this data, wise sensing units can maximize water use, lowering waste and making certain that landscapes receive the ideal amount of dampness. This technology not only saves water however also advertises much healthier plant growth by preventing overwatering or underwatering. In addition, the automation supplied by wise weather condition sensors boosts individual benefit, as landscapers and home owners can rely on specific watering routines without manual intervention. Overall, these advancements stand for a significant improvement in lasting irrigation methods.

Dirt Moisture Sensors
Soil wetness sensors play an essential role in modern-day watering systems, giving real-time information that enhances water effectiveness. These tools determine the volumetric water content in the soil, enabling for accurate analyses of moisture degrees. By incorporating soil wetness sensors right into irrigation systems, individuals can stay clear of overwatering or underwatering, eventually promoting healthier plant growth and saving water resources.The sensing units transmit data to controllers, which can readjust sprinkling schedules based on current soil problems. This data-driven method minimizes water waste and warranties that plants get the finest amount of wetness. Furthermore, soil wetness sensors can be helpful in numerous agricultural setups, from home gardens to large-scale ranches. The implementation of these sensing units adds to sustainable techniques by supporting responsible water usage and reducing ecological effect. Generally, the consolidation of dirt moisture sensors notes a considerable innovation in attaining effective irrigation systems.
